#1059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1059ba is composed of 6.3% red, 34.9%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 214.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#1059ba color hex could be obtained by blending #20b2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1059ba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1059ba has RGB values of R:16, G:89,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1071546.

Shades and Tints of #1059ba
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000305 is the darkest color, while #f2f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1059ba
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e646c is the less saturated color, while #0057ca is the most saturated one.
